Understanding the ECO Scheme: A Brief Background

The Energy Company Obligation (ECO) scheme has been a cornerstone of the UK government’s efforts to improve energy efficiency in homes. Since its inception in 2013, ECO has aimed to reduce carbon emissions, lower energy bills, and tackle fuel poverty by funding energy-efficient home improvements. Over the years, the scheme has evolved from ECO1 to ECO3, adapting to changing priorities and challenges. In 2022, ECO4 was introduced as the latest phase, and now in 2024, it continues to expand with new updates and regulations.

What’s Different in ECO4?

ECO4 represents a significant shift from previous schemes, particularly ECO3, in terms of eligibility, funding focus, and the types of improvements covered. The 2024 update has introduced key changes aimed at reaching more households and achieving long-term energy efficiency.


New EPC Requirements

One of the major changes in the 2024 ECO4 update is the focus on homes with lower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) ratings. Under ECO3, properties with an EPC rating of E, F, or G were prioritized, but ECO4 has extended support to homes rated D, provided they meet specific criteria. This means more households can qualify for funding to upgrade outdated or inefficient heating systems.


LA Flex Expanded

Local Authority Flexible Eligibility (LA Flex) has been expanded under the ECO4 scheme. In previous versions, LA Flex was limited to certain councils and had stricter guidelines. In 2024, more local authorities can participate, enabling councils to assist households that might not meet the standard criteria but still need support. This change means that more people, particularly those on the brink of fuel poverty, can access grants for energy-saving improvements.

Updated Benefit Criteria

While previous schemes primarily targeted households on income-based benefits, ECO4 now includes a wider range of financial criteria. The 2024 update has also streamlined the application process for those on Universal Credit, Working Tax Credit, and Housing Benefit. This change makes it easier for working families and vulnerable households to access grants.

Focus on Long-Term Energy Efficiency

Unlike previous schemes, ECO4 puts a stronger emphasis on holistic home upgrades rather than single improvements. This means combining insulation, modern heating systems, and renewable energy installations for a comprehensive energy efficiency boost. The goal is to significantly increase a home’s EPC rating, making heating more affordable in the long run.
